drive fluid dripping from water pickup....
After sitting last week I noticed a very small puddle of drive oil under one drive. It is coming from the water pickup holes on the side of the drive. It has not lost much fluid at all, may 1/4 in in the bottle. In the water it did not leak the week before. The drived were just off for a repaint this spring and the boat has only been in the water a couple times. I am assuming I have a bad seal but which one? Can anyone point me in the right direction? It is a 1998 Bravo 1 drive.

most of the time when drive oil is dripping out the water pick up it is the o ring between the upper and lower

Re: drive fluid dripping from water pickup....
There are two orings and a seal that is called a Quad seal. I would replace all three, and make sure the surfaces they mate with are clean, no nicks or bumps, etc..

Re: drive fluid dripping from water pickup....
The one front O-ring is for the speed-o pickup right? The two back a little further are for water and oil right? I have a nose cone so the speed-o pickup should not be an issue.

Re: drive fluid dripping from water pickup....
The fat one is for the speedo, then there is a large one that isolates the water pickup and in that one is the quad seal, isolating the oil passage, then there is the oring around the vertical shaft.. that is an oil cavity
